just got a quote from our campus reseller, that readzilla and logzilla
are not available for the X4540 - hmm strange.... Anyway, wondering
whether it is possible/supported/would make sense to use a Sun Flash
Accelerator F20 PCIe Card in a X4540 instead of 2.5" SSDs?
If so, is it possible to "partition" the F20, e.g. into 36 GB "logzilla",
60GB "readzilla" (also interesting for other Xnnnn servers)?

IIRC the card presents 4x LUNs so you could use each of them for different purpose.
You could also use different slices.
